Patent number: 11960648Abstract: A method for determining a current viewing direction of a user of a pair of data glasses having a virtual retina scan display. The method includes at least the method steps: projecting at least substantially parallel infrared laser beams onto an eye of a user of the data glasses, acquiring two-dimensional images from the infrared laser beams reflected back by the eye of the user, and determining pupil contours in the acquired two-dimensional images. The instantaneous viewing direction of the user of the data glasses is ascertained from a comparison of an instantaneous elliptical shape of the pupil contour with an elliptical shape of a reference pupil contour.Type: GrantFiled: March 24, 2023Date of Patent: April 16, 2024Assignee: ROBERT BOSCH GMBHInventor: Johannes Meyer

Patent number: 11948524Abstract: The present application provides a logic circuit and a display panel. One end of a switching control module of the logic circuit is connected in series with a voltage adjusting control module, and another end of the switching control module is connected in series with a switch component of a voltage adjusting module. Also, the switching control module connected in series with the same switch component has at least two different operational currents for a corresponding switch component to have different switching speeds for alleviating the problem of excessive electromagnetic interference (EMI) occurred in a power management chip of existing LCD products.Type: GrantFiled: July 23, 2021Date of Patent: April 2, 2024Assignee: TCL CHINA STAR OPTOELECTRONICS TECHNOLOGY CO., LTD.Inventor: Wenfang Li

Patent number: 11942868Abstract: A power provider includes: first, second, and third inductors; a first transistor connected to the second inductor; a second transistor connected to the third inductor; and a power integrated chip (IC) including input terminals connected to the first, second, and third inductors, and an output terminal connected to a power line. The power provider may supply the power voltage using the first inductor and the power IC when power current is less than a first reference value, supply the power voltage using the second inductor, the first transistor, and the power IC when the power current is greater than the first reference value and less than a second reference value, and supply the power voltage using the second and third inductors, the first and second transistors, and the power IC when the power current is greater than the second reference value.Type: GrantFiled: January 11, 2023Date of Patent: March 26, 2024Assignee: SAMSUNG DISPLAY CO., LTD.Inventors: Yoon Young Lee, Sung Chun Park
